For example the Corrente flow sensor impeller pictured below. The shaft and the circlip holding the magnet in place are metal and the tip looks like some kind of ceramic although it may just be the reflection making it look that way.
Normally these things are out of sight so you wouldn't notice corrosion unless you took the thing apart for maintenance.
corrente-water-flow-sensor-7.jpg
 
It really depends on what kind of metal they are. Even stainless steel will corode depending on the alloy used. Titanium is really the only thing really suitable in the long run. If they were titanium I would ecpect the manufacturer to say so.
 
I was surprised when PRS told me that the Corrente flow sensor uses 304 stainless steel. I was expecting it be be 316L at least.
304 grade isn't designed for constant salt water immersion. Even 316L grade is only recommended if the water is guaranteed to be oxygen rich so the protective oxide film is preserved.

I went searching for flow sensors that are specifically salt tolerant, but there is a lack of technical information about the materials used. It seems that vendors are just repackaging the fresh water variety for use in salt water conditions without considering the life expectancy. Inexpensive pond pumps often use ceramic bearings presumably because they don't corrode.
 
Ceramic bearings do not corrode and they have very good wear properties as well as low friction.
